Aurangabad, Oct 13:

An audio clip of a local bus driver of Maharashtra State Road Transport Corporation (MSRTC) has gone viral on social media today. He is questioning in the clip on how to feed the family of six persons as he had got the salary of Rs 930 only.

In the audio clip, the driver is speaking to a lady officer. When the driver mentions about his meagre salary, the lady officer tells him to visit the depot and get his queries answered. Sensation prevailed as two days ago, one MSRTC employee from Nasik had committed suicide after he got a salary of Rs 223.

When inquired, it came to know that the name of the driver is Madhav Jamkar. When contacted, he informed about getting Rs 930 as the salary for July. He also mentioned problems he is facing due to shortage of money.

Meanwhile, the repeated efforts to contact the depot manager of Cidco Bus Stand, Amol Bhusari, proved futile as his mobile phone was switched off. Meanwhile, the MSRTC sources mentioned that the said driver was absent on duty. Hence, the salary was released to him as per his working days.
